Paws of Courage: True Tales of Heroic Dogs that Protect and Serve
By Nancy Furstinger
Lucca lost a leg for her owner. Xanto sniffs out bombs. Smoky's only food was her owner's shared tins. What could be more heroic than these hero dogs? From world war two to modern times, police dogs have been helping us for a long time. In this book, you will read the stories of several hero dogs who protected their masters against all odds.
